Abstract

A kind of compost that can improve Hericium erinaceus yield provided by the invention, it is by mulberry tree twig powder 37 45 by weight ratio, grape twig powder 37 45, wheat bran 18 22, sucrose 0.8 1.2 and gypsum 0.8 1.2 are made, and not only raw material sources are extensive for this compost, and feeding is easy, and cultivation Hericium erinaceus yield and quality and use weed tree sawdust, cottonseed shell cultivation it is similar, and cost is low.

Description

A kind of compost that can improve Hericium erinaceus yield
Technical field
The present invention relates to edible mushroom, specifically a kind of compost that can improve Hericium erinaceus yield.
Background technology
The nutritional ingredient of edible mushroom is between meat and vegetables, the protein content of general edible mushroom is its dry 30% or so, also contain amino acid and vitamin and mineral matter needed by human, there are some edible mushrooms to also have medical value, develop edible mushroom for providing healthy food, get rich for peasant, for twice laid, develop the economy all significant.
Have not yet to see the report made carbon source with mulberry tree branch, grape branch the like waste and made the compost of cultivation Hericium erinaceus.
The content of the invention
It is an object of the present invention to provide a kind of compost that can improve Hericium erinaceus yield, and this compost is not only containing the nutrition required for the edible mushrooms such as lignin, cellulose and hemicellulose, and wide material sources, feeding are easy.
A kind of compost that can improve Hericium erinaceus yield, it is made up of following raw materials by weight ratio:
Mulberry tree twig powder 37-45
Grape twig powder 37-45
Wheat bran 18-22
Sucrose 0.8-1.2
Gypsum 0.8-1.2.
Further, the weight of each raw material is:Mulberry tree twig powder 40, grape twig powder 38, wheat bran 20, sucrose 1, gypsum 1.
Described mulberry tree branch is to be dried after plucking mulberry leaf without the mulberry branch to go mouldy, breaks into chip through disintegrating machine, mulberry branch contains crude protein 5.8%, and cellulose 52%, lignin 18%, hemicellulose 23%, trophic structure is rationally the carbon source material of good culturing edible fungus.
Described grape twig powder is that the grape branch that will be trimmed dries, chip is broken into disintegrating machine, the content 290-420mg/g of cellulose in grape branch, hemicellulose level 80-210mg/g, the content 280-490mg/g of lignin, and contain protein and soluble sugar, it is entirely capable of meeting needs of the edible fungi growth to carbon source.Both coordinate the carbon source material that trophic structure is rationally good culturing edible fungus.
A kind of preparation method for the compost that can improve Hericium erinaceus yield is:Weighing by weight ratio, mulberry tree twig powder, grape branch crumb lime supernatant are prewetted 1 day, then mixed thoroughly with wheat bran, sucrose, gypsum, pack sterilization forms.
It is an advantage of the invention that:Not only raw material sources are extensive, and feeding is easy, and cultivate Hericium erinaceus yield and quality and use weed tree sawdust, cottonseed shell cultivation it is similar, and cost is low.
Embodiment
Present invention is further elaborated below by embodiment, but is not limitation of the invention.
Embodiment
A kind of compost that can improve Hericium erinaceus yield, weigh 40 kilograms of mulberry tree twig powder, 38 kilograms of grape twig powder, 20 kilograms of wheat bran, 1 kilogram of sucrose, 1 kilogram of gypsum, mulberry tree twig powder and grape branch crumb lime supernatant are prewetted 1 day, then mixed thoroughly with wheat bran, sucrose, gypsum, pack sterilization forms.
